Product details

Overview

The MAX6309UK31D3 from Maxim Integrated is a 5-pin SOT23 programmable supervisory IC that monitors VCC (factory-set at 3.08V ±2.5%), an adjustable undervoltage input (RST IN), and a manual-reset input (MR) to assert an active-low push/pull RESET signal. It guarantees valid reset assertion down to VCC = 1V, features 140ms minimum reset timeout, consumes only 8µA supply current, and rejects fast transients-making it ideal for multivoltage embedded control systems requiring reliable power-on and brownout protection.

Technical Context

The MAX6309UK31D3 implements a dual-monitoring architecture: a factory-trimmed internal voltage divider sets the primary VCC reset threshold at 3.08V, while a separate comparator monitors the RST IN pin against a precise 1.23V reference (±0.03V). Its push/pull RESET output drives high/low without external pull-up, enabling direct interface with µP reset inputs requiring active-high or active-low logic levels depending on system design.

Reset assertion occurs when either VCC falls below 3.08V (±2.5% over temperature), RST IN drops below 1.23V, or MR is pulled low. The internal timer enforces a guaranteed minimum 140ms reset pulse width after all monitored conditions return to valid states, and the device remains functional across -40°C to +85°C with guaranteed operation down to VCC = 1V.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
VCC Reset Threshold3.08V ±2.5% over -40°C to +85°C - factory-trimmed for stable 3.3V rail monitoring without external components
Reset Timeout Period140ms (min) - ensures sufficient hold time for microprocessor initialization before release
Supply Current8µA (typ) at VCC = 5.5V - enables use in battery-powered portable equipment with minimal quiescent drain
RESET Output TypeActive-low push/pull - eliminates need for external pull-up resistor and supports direct µP reset pin drive
RST IN Threshold1.23V ±0.03V - precise internal reference allows accurate monitoring of secondary supplies via external resistor divider
MR Input Pull-up63.5kΩ (typ) - permits momentary switch connection without external biasing; TTL/CMOS compatible
Operating Voltage RangeVCC = (VTH + 2.5%) to +5.5V - minimum VCC = 3.16V for full functionality, supporting 3.3V systems

Pinout & Package

MAX6309UK31D3 is housed in a 5-pin SOT23 package (outline U5+1, land pattern 90-0174), optimized for space-constrained PCB layouts and reflow-compatible assembly. Pin 1 is RESET, Pin 2 is GND, Pin 3 is RST IN, Pin 4 is MR, and Pin 5 is VCC - verified from Maxim's official pin configuration diagram for MAX6306/MAX6309/MAX6312 variants.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 - RESETActive-low push/pull reset outputDrives low to assert reset; sources current when high - no external pull-up required
2 - GNDSystem ground referenceCommon return path for all internal comparators and output stage
3 - RST INAdjustable undervoltage monitor inputCompares external voltage (via resistor divider) to 1.23V reference; asserts reset if input falls below threshold
4 - MRManual reset inputPull low to force reset; internal 63.5kΩ pull-up enables switch-only implementation
5 - VCCMain supply and primary monitor railPower source and monitored voltage; internal trimmed divider sets 3.08V reset point

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Factory-set 3.08V VCC thresholdEliminates external resistor network for 3.3V rail supervision - reduces BOM count and layout area
140ms minimum reset timeoutGuarantees µP core and peripherals fully stabilize before release - prevents premature code execution
Push/pull RESET outputSupports direct connection to µP reset pins without pull-up resistors - simplifies schematic and improves noise immunity
RST IN with 1.23V precision referenceEnables accurate monitoring of secondary rails (e.g., 1.8V, 2.5V) using two standard resistors - no trimming required
MR input with integrated pull-upAllows single-pole momentary switch to ground for field service reset - no additional bias components needed

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ar supervisory circuit appl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
MAX6312UK31D3Includes overvoltage reset input (OVRST IN); same 3.08V VCC threshold and 140ms timeoutRequired where 3.3V rail overvoltage protection (e.g., LDO failure) is mandatedSelect MAX6312UK31D3 only if OVRST IN functionality is needed; otherwise MAX6309UK31D3 offers lower cost and simpler layout
TPS3808G33DBVRFixed 3.3V threshold (±0.5%), 200ms timeout, open-drain output, 1.6µA supply currentLacks RST IN and MR inputs; requires external pull-up; suited for basic single-rail monitoringChoose TPS3808G33DBVR for ultra-low-power applications where secondary monitoring and manual reset are unnecessary

Compared with MAX6312UK31D3, the MAX6309UK31D3 omits overvoltage detection to reduce complexity and cost while retaining identical VCC supervision and manual reset capability; versus TPS3808G33DBVR, it provides greater flexibility with dual-input monitoring and push/pull output but at higher quiescent current.

FAQ

What is the exact factory-programmed VCC reset threshold for MAX6309UK31D3?

The MAX6309UK31D3 has a factory-trimmed VCC reset threshold of 3.08V, with ±2.5% tolerance over the full -40°C to +85°C operating temperature range. This value is confirmed in Table 1 of the datasheet under "31" index (3.034V min / 3.080V typ / 3.126V max at +25°C), and applies specifically to the MAX6309UK31D3 variant - not inferred from adjacent part numbers. The threshold is set by an internal precision voltage divider and requires no external calibration.

Does MAX6309UK31D3 support monitoring of a second voltage rail besides VCC?

Yes, MAX6309UK31D3 supports secondary rail monitoring via its RST IN pin, which compares an externally applied voltage (using a resistor divider) against a precise 1.23V internal reference. This enables supervision of rails such as 1.8V or 2.5V alongside the primary 3.3V VCC supply. The RST IN input features ±25nA leakage and built-in hysteresis, allowing megohm-level divider resistors and noise immunity - a capability explicitly documented for MAX6309 in the Pin Description and Adjustable Reset Inputs sections.

What is the function and electrical behavior of the MR pin on MAX6309UK31D3?

The MR (Manual Reset) pin on MAX6309UK31D3 is an active-low input with an internal 63.5kΩ pull-up resistor. Pulling MR low forces immediate reset assertion, which persists for the full 140ms timeout period after MR returns high. The pin accepts TTL logic in 5V systems and CMOS levels in 3V systems, and its ESD protection requires MR's driving supply to match VCC to prevent forward-biasing. This behavior is specified in the Electrical Characteristics table under "MR Input" parameters and confirmed in the Detailed Description section.

Is the RESET output of MAX6309UK31D3 open-drain or push/pull?

The RESET output of MAX6309UK31D3 is active-low push/pull, meaning it actively drives both high and low states without requiring an external pull-up resistor. This is confirmed in the Pin Description table ("Active-Low, Push/Pull Reset Output for the MAX6308/MAX6309/MAX6310") and Electrical Characteristics (VOH/VOL specs showing sourcing/sinking capability at defined VCC and current conditions). Unlike open-drain variants (e.g., MAX6305), MAX6309UK31D3's output structure simplifies interface with µP reset pins requiring driven logic levels.

What is the minimum VCC voltage at which MAX6309UK31D3 guarantees valid RESET assertion?

MAX6309UK31D3 guarantees valid RESET assertion down to VCC = 1V, as explicitly stated in the Features list ("Guaranteed RESET Valid to VCC = 1V") and Electrical Characteristics table (VOL/VOH test conditions including VCC > 1.0V). Below 1V, output drive strength degrades significantly; however, for all normal operation within its specified VCC range (≥3.16V, per "VCC = (VTH + 2.5%) to +5.5V"), the device maintains full reset functionality with guaranteed timing and voltage levels.
